What is Wimbledon: 2015 Official Film Review (2015) about?

This documentary takes viewers behind the scenes of the 2015 Wimbledon Championships, following tennis stars as they chase glory on the legendary grass courts. It highlights Novak Đoković's title defense and Serena Williams' pursuit of a historic Grand Slam, alongside other top players' journeys.

Who directed Wimbledon: 2015 Official Film Review?

Cathy Jones directed this official film review, bringing a dynamic and immersive perspective to the tournament.

Who stars in Wimbledon: 2015 Official Film Review?

The film features tennis icons Novak Đoković, Roger Federer, Serena Williams, Andy Murray, and Garbiñe Muguruza, alongside commentator Stephen Fry.

About Wimbledon: 2015 Official Film Review (2015) — The Drama, Stars, and Glory of Tennis' Greatest Stage

Dive into the electrifying atmosphere of the 2015 Wimbledon Championships with *Wimbledon: 2015 Official Film Review (2015)*, directed by Cathy Jones. This gripping documentary captures the drama, triumphs, and near-misses of tennis' most prestigious grass-court tournament, weaving together the high-stakes narratives of defending champion Novak Đoković's bid for a third straight title and Serena Williams' quest to achieve the elusive Grand Slam. The film also spotlights tennis legends like Roger Federer and Andy Murray, alongside rising star Garbiñe Muguruza, as they battle for glory under the iconic Centre Court roof.

With a blend of cinematic storytelling and behind-the-scenes insight, *Wimbledon: 2015 Official Film Review* delivers a front-row seat to the tournament's most unforgettable moments, from shocking early exits to historic milestones.
